Azure Linux 3.0 Security Update: gssntlmssp (CVE-2023-25567)

high Nessus Plugin ID 295222

Synopsis

The remote Azure Linux host is missing one or more security updates.

Description

The version of gssntlmssp installed on the remote Azure Linux 3.0 host is prior to tested version. It is, therefore, affected by a vulnerability as referenced in the CVE-2023-25567 advisory.

- GSS-NTLMSSP, a mechglue plugin for the GSSAPI library that implements NTLM authentication, has an out-of- bounds read when decoding target information prior to version 1.2.0. The length of the `av_pair` is not checked properly for two of the elements which can trigger an out-of-bound read. The out-of-bounds read can be triggered via the main `gss_accept_sec_context` entry point and could cause a denial-of-service if the memory is unmapped. The issue is fixed in version 1.2.0. (CVE-2023-25567)
